RAMOS, Maria Beatriz Jacques. The interpretation in psychoanalytic studies. Estud. psicanal. [online]. 2009, n.32, pp. 103-110. ISSN 0100-3437.

The psychoanalytic treatment is a history of meetings. Analysing speech, it offers a subject; the analyst begins to listen. The asymmetry not always is lasting, so the transfer brings histories and imaginary significations. The analytical process is complex, it is a tangle of actions, interactions and reciprocal actions. The analyst punctuates the speech with interpretations, tie space and time, it tries to cancel the work of the impulse death. To illustrate these reflections I present a history between so many people others, which worry and make possible changes of apex, of looking, on the constitution and psychological structuring I eat in case of the Guardian of Memories.

Keywords : Analytical listening; Interpretation; Narcissism; Perversion.
